Hello,

Been enjoying FS2Crew the last few years. Great product. However, I would love to have the oportunity to fly as a first officer, and not only as a captain. Is this something that has ever been considered?

It's been considered, but it's complex.  A lot of the checklists and actions on the ground are initiated by the left seat pilot.  How would we know when to trigger certain events given that we can't really "see" the world like a human pair of eyes can.

To have a left seat pilot we need a level of AI that is well beyond the capability of flightsim.

I also imagine that some items that are handled by the captain will also have to be performed by the user who is in the FO seat. For example, on some aircraft, the Capt performs the taxi and after landing he takes control from the F.O. 

It would indeed be complex and it may perhaps require some compromise here and there.
